Digital platforms have fundamentally transformed the sports broadcasting landscape by providing viewers extraordinary flexibility and control over their viewing experiences. Unlike conventional TV airings, streaming solutions offer on-demand access, multiple viewing angles, interactive features, and personalized content recommendations that address individual preferences. The shift toward electronic dissemination has indeed enabled broadcasters to get to worldwide audiences without the geographical limitations mandated by traditional terrestrial or satellite TV networks. Streaming technology allows for adaptive bitrate streaming, ensuring peak viewing standard irrespective of internet speed or tool capabilities. The interactive nature of streaming platforms has indeed even brought about brand-new interaction opportunities, including real-time chat aspects, social media blending, and real-time voting that transforms passive watching into proactive participation. The technological infrastructure supporting contemporary sports broadcasting symbolizes an advanced network of equipment, personnel, and digital systems operating in harmony to provide seamless viewing experiences. HD video cameras, state-of-the-art audio tools, and real-time graphics systems have actually transformed into standard components in expert sporting event production. Broadcasting crews make use of various cam angles, slow-motion replay capabilities, and improved audio capture to provide detailed coverage that brings viewers closer to the action than ever before. The blending of artificial intelligence and ML algorithms has additionally enhanced output standard, allowing automated camera tracking, swift statistical analysis, and forecast graphics that enhance audience understanding. These tech advances demand substantial investment from broadcasting companies, but the resulting enhancement in audience interaction and fulfillment validates the cost. International broadcasting rights discussions have certainly evolved into more complex as sports organizations seek to optimize revenue whilst guaranteeing global reach for their activities. The read more value of exclusive broadcasting deals has risen dramatically, with networks and streaming services contending intensively for premium materials that drives customer expansion and advertising profits. These discussions frequently engage various stakeholders, including athletic regulatory bodies, league bodies, and media companies, each looking for to optimize their individual concerns. The globalization of sports has created opportunities for broadcasters to increase their reach outside home markets, leading to innovative collaboration deals and material sharing agreements.
